Output 51f6e1354a7fe26d3451d22b2850dac834261aec3a14f0aea3d6a48c7f343af3:1

value
517896
script pubkey
OP_0 OP_PUSHBYTES_20 963a55d9ef0effdb5ea76041c1567fc9405c4283
address
ltc1qjca9tk00pmlakh48vpquz4nle9q9cs5r9wplx4
transaction
51f6e1354a7fe26d3451d22b2850dac834261aec3a14f0aea3d6a48c7f343af3
spent
true